According to reports, Evelyn Ngige, wife of the current Minister of Labour Chris Ngige, under the President Buhari-led administration has just approved as Permanent Secretary alongside eight others by President Muhammadu Buhari.

According to the report, the announcement concerning the President’s approval of the appointment of the Permanent Secretaries was made by Dr. Folasade Yemi-Esan, the Acting Head of the Civil Service of the Federation (Ag. HsCSF).

A ceremony to swear-in the appointed Permanent Secretaries held at the Council Chamber of the Presidential Villa prior to the weekly Federal Executive Council(FEC) meeting.

The names of the newly sworn-in Permanent secretaries are Dr. Evelyn Ngige from Delta, representing South-South; Hassan Musa from Borno; Olusola Idowu from Ogun; David Adejoh from Kogi to represent the North-Central.

Others are Umar Idris Tijani from Bauchi, representing North-East; Dr Sanni Gwarzo from Kano representing North-East; Engr. Nebolisa Anako from Kano representing South-East and Temitope Faseun from Ondo representing the South-West.
